This is a good time for spellwork and personal action devoted to creating the YOU you want to be. Now is the time to "find yourself" and define yourself. Take a good look at yourself, are you happy with who you are? What to do other people say about you? Does that please you? If there are changes to be made, now is the time! This is not so much the time for negative actions, such as removing things (like breaking bad habits) but if that's all you've got, run with it. More appropriate is adding things, like finding that new job, registering for classes at a university, getting a makeover, starting a new workout program, whatever it is you think you need to do to become the person you want to be. The new moon in Aries is about forward action, not abstinance. The time of waiting and preparation is over. Let's go!
April 20th is the Full Pink Moon. This name was given to this moon due to the native pink phlox that grow wild all over the United States, but especially in the midwest. They are among the first flowers that bloom en masse after the barren cold winter of this region.
